The Notice of First Stockholder’s Meeting is a vital document for corporations in Washington, designed to officially announce the inaugural meeting of stockholders. This form outlines essential details such as the date, time, and location of the meeting, ensuring compliance with corporate by-laws. It is crucial for establishing formal communication among stockholders and fostering transparency within the corporation. Users need to fill in specific information including the date, time, and the name and address of the corporation. How do you start a corporation? Select a business name. Ensure the corporate name you plan to register is not already in use. Designate a board of directors. File articles of incorporation. Draft corporate bylaws. Obtain an Employer Identification Number (EIN). Issue stock.

How to Form a Corporation in Washington Choose a Corporate Name. Choose Directors to serve on the Board of Directors. Prepare and file the Articles of Incorporation. Apply for a Federal Employer Identification Number (EIN) Write Corporate Bylaws. Create a Shareholder Agreement. Elect S Corporation status if desired.

Yes, a single member LLC can form an S Corp. This structure is popular among solo entrepreneurs who want to benefit from the tax advantages of an S Corporation and the liability protection of an LLC.

In summary, LLCs offer more flexibility in management and taxation, while corporations have a more standardized structure that may be better suited for businesses seeking outside investment.

3 Steps to Obtaining your Washington UBI Number: Submit your WA Articles of Incorporation or Certificate of Formation. For a Washington LLC or Washington corporation you can either file online or download a PDF and file by mail (see links below). Wait for confirmation. Find UBI Number.
